Output 1917858f3f127fdaec04722a2db96f74c3314352e2e333708011e2501abd3694:12

value
2621919010
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d332ee315e668b2e0e337a0b2b2011e99b6fe6 OP_EQUALVERIFY OP_CHECKSIG
address
176Lc2DL6sUF5W4rp1itkNBw3ELR3NiLLS
transaction
1917858f3f127fdaec04722a2db96f74c3314352e2e333708011e2501abd3694
spent
true